AN ORDINANCE ESTABLISHING THE RATES OF PAY FOR POLICE
OFFICERS, EXCLUDING THE POLICE CHIEF, OF THE CITY OF FORT THOMAS, CAMPBELL
COUNTY, KENTUCKY, FOR THE 2008-2009 FISCAL YEAR, AND ESTABLISHING THE MANNER OF
PAYING SUCH COMPENSATION.
BE
IT ORDAINED BY THE CITY OF
That the rates of pay of the officers of the Police Department, and the regular patrol officers, be and the same are hereby fixed and determined so that said employees shall receive for their services pay at the following rates for the 2008-2009 Fiscal Year beginning on the first day of July, 2008, as hereinafter shown:
POSITION 2008-2009
HOURLY RATE
Lieutenant $30.36
Sergeant $26.95
Senior Police Officer (10 or more years) $24.35
Senior Police Officer (5 or more years) $24.23
Police Officer, First Class $24.06
Police Officer, Second Class $23.25
Police Recruit $22.48
